Itinerary
Day 1: Cape Town to Stellenbosch
Stop At: Mojo Hotel, 30 Regent Rd, Sea Point, Cape Town, 8060, South Africa
Welcome to South Africa! We’ll meet and greet at the Mojo Hotel before we hit the road for the Stellenbosch Winelands.
Duration: 1 hour
Stop At: Stellenbosch Wine Routes, 47 Church Street, Stellenbosch 7600 South Africa
The second oldest town in South Africa, Stellenbosch is known for its natural beauty and oak-lined avenues, Cape Dutch architecture, history and culture – and of course its wine routes. Today we will embark on a journey to three different wineries learning about the oldest wine route in the country.
Duration: 5 hours
Stop At: Elgin Railway Market, Oak Road Elgin Railway Station, Elgin South Africa
Tonight we’ll head to the Elgin Railway Market where you can enjoy dinner at your leisure. An apple warehouse turned bustling steampunk station market, boasts local vendors, live music and a gateway to the beautiful Overberg town.
Duration: 3 hours
No meals included on this day.
Accommodation included: Wildekrans Wine Estate
Day 2: Stellenbosch with a day trip to Hermanus
Stop At: Hermanus, Hermanus, Overstrand, Overberg District, Western Cape
After a hearty breakfast we head to Hermanus, situated in the heart of the Cape Whale Route. This once-humble fishing village has maintained its rustic charm and natural beauty while offering outdoor enthusiasts a range of activities. You will have the option of kayaking or trying out stand up paddle boarding (SUP) in the whale watching capital of the world.
Duration: 3 hours
Stop At: Hemel en Aarde, Hermanus, 7200, South Africa
‘Heaven on earth’ is the English translation of Hemel en Aarde, and this is certainly one of the most beautiful of South Africa’s wine regions. We’ll visit two different wineries sampling the famous pinot noir and chardonnay grapes that this region is famous for.
Duration: 3 hours
Stop At: Wildekrans Wine Estate, R43, Bot River, 7185, South Africa
After a full day of adventure and wine we head back to our wine estate for the evening. Kick back and enjoy the breath-taking views and a tranquil atmosphere before dinner. Tonight’s dinner features a traditional South African braai with an assortment of salads and sundowners to end this glorious day.
Duration: 12 hours
Meals included:
• Breakfast
• Dinner: Traditional South African Braai
Accommodation included: Wildekrans Wine Estate
Day 3: Stellenbosch to Cape Town
Stop At: Cape Canopy Tour, Forestry Rd, South Africa
After breakfast today we’re headed to our Cape Canopy tour, where it’s time for ziplining. We soar with eagles, surrounded by breath-taking Cape fynbos panoramas and mountainscapes.
Duration: 4 hours
Stop At: Cape Town, Cape Town, Western Cape
We embark on a scenic drive along R44 Clarence Road for panoramic views of the coastline, Table Mountain, and beyond before arriving back in Cape Town.
Duration: 3 hours
Meals included:
• Breakfast
• Lunch
No accommodation included on this day.
